Desenvolvimento de aplicativos móveis Xamarin: crie para iOS e Android

Domine o desenvolvimento móvel multiplataforma criando aplicativos nativos para iOS e Android usando uma única base de código C# e Xamarin.

4.7 (4,608) ⏱ 1 h 19 min 📚 7 aulas 🎧 Versão em áudio

Sobre este curso

Desenvolver aplicativos nativos separados para iOS e Android geralmente requer o aprendizado de várias linguagens de programação e a manutenção de duas bases de código distintas.Com o Xamarin, você pode aproveitar o C# para criar aplicativos móveis nativos de alto desempenho para ambas as plataformas simultaneamente a partir de uma única base de código compartilhada. Este curso orienta você através dos princípios essenciais do desenvolvimento multiplataforma, mostrando como maximizar a reutilização de código ao mesmo tempo em que oferece experiências de usuário nativas.Você fará a transição da compreensão da arquitetura móvel básica para a estruturação de aplicativos limpos e mantidos prontos para a implantação no mundo real. O que você vai aprender: - Entenda a arquitetura fundamental do Xamarin e como funciona a compilação entre plataformas. - Projete interfaces de usuário responsivas usando Xamarin.Forms e controles de layout nativos. - Aplique o padrão de arquitetura MVVM (Model-View-ViewModel) para separar a lógica de negócios da interface do usuário. - Integre APIs RESTful e lide com operações de dados assíncronas usando padrões C # assíncronos / aguardados modernos. - Configurar o armazenamento de dados local e lidar com a sincronização offline para dispositivos móveis. - Saiba como os conceitos do Xamarin fazem a transição para o moderno ecossistema.NET MAUI para o desenvolvimento à prova de futuro. Você começará com a terminologia móvel e os conceitos de ambiente antes de passar para o design da interface do usuário, gerenciamento de estado e integração de serviços.Através de explicações claras por escrito, passo a passo de código estruturado e exercícios práticos baseados em texto, você construirá uma compreensão funcional da engenharia móvel. Este curso é projetado para iniciantes e aspirantes a desenvolvedores móveis que desejam expandir suas habilidades; uma familiaridade básica com o C # é útil, mas nenhuma experiência prévia de desenvolvimento móvel é necessária. Comece a ler hoje para desbloquear o potencial do desenvolvimento móvel multiplataforma.

O que você vai receber

  • 📜 Certificado de conclusão
    Adicione ao seu perfil do LinkedIn
  • 🎧 Versão em áudio incluída
    Estude em qualquer lugar, sem tela
  • ♾️ Acesso vitalício
    Volte quando quiser, sem expirar
  • 📱 Celular ou computador
    Funciona em qualquer dispositivo
  • 💸 Reembolso em 30 dias
    Sem perguntas
  • Curto e focado
    1 h 19 min de conteúdo prático

Avaliações (7)

Anna Ozoliņa LV Aluno verificado
★ 4 · 2025-09-02T08:34:52+00:00

Conteúdo sólido aqui. Enquanto alguns dos módulos poderiam ter sido mais detalhados, o valor geral e a aplicabilidade são altos.

Đỗ Văn Dũng VN
★ 3 · 2025-06-13T17:36:52+00:00

Machine Translated Eu gostei dos exemplos de aplicação prática, embora a configuração inicial tenha demorado mais do que eu esperava.

Sophie Schneider DE Aluno verificado
★ 5 · 2025-04-25T12:01:52+00:00

Gostei muito disso. A estrutura fluiu perfeitamente, e as aplicações práticas são imediatamente úteis.

中村 悠真 JP Aluno verificado
★ 4 · 2025-04-18T13:23:52+00:00

Os exemplos foram principalmente úteis. Pode precisar de prática adicional em outro lugar para o domínio.

Harper Thompson NZ Aluno verificado
★ 4 · 2025-04-16T14:24:52+00:00

Os exemplos foram úteis, mas eu gostaria que houvesse um pouco mais de material de prática. Valor sólido para o custo.

Peter Kováč SK Aluno verificado
★ 3 · 2025-03-16T15:31:52+00:00

É uma introdução decente, mas poderia se beneficiar de exemplos mais diversos e um fluxo ligeiramente melhor entre os módulos.

Guntis Vītols LV
★ 5 · 2025-01-04T01:52:52+00:00

Este curso excedeu minhas expectativas. As aplicações do mundo real discutidas são incrivelmente úteis.

Escrever uma avaliação

Pediremos para fazer login após enviar — o rascunho fica salvo.

Outros também fizeram

Perguntas frequentes

O que preciso para fazer este curso? +

Só um celular ou computador com internet. Sem instalações nem hardware especial.

Como faço para pagar? +

Cartão via Stripe ou criptomoeda. Não guardamos dados do cartão — o Stripe processa com segurança.

Posso pedir reembolso? +

Sim — reembolso integral em 30 dias, sem perguntas.

Por quanto tempo terei acesso? +

Para sempre. Uma vez comprado, o curso é seu para revisar quando quiser.

Vou receber um certificado? +

Sim. Ao concluir, você recebe um certificado que pode adicionar ao seu perfil do LinkedIn.

Feito para profissionais em
Tecnologia Design Finanças Marketing Saúde Educação Hotelaria Indústria